You can drive as far as you have to if the road is pretty straight. Don't make any really tight turns but as long as the center diff isn't locked you should be OK.
You are probably limited to about 25 to 30 mph. You may be pushing the rev limiter much beyond that.

Thanks for the reply. Much appreciated. My LX 570 is stuck in 4Lo and I need to get it to a service centre so had some conflicting information about driving it there about 20 miles.

I assume you have tried rocking it back and forth in forward and reverse on level ground then putting it in neutral and trying to switch back to 4hi. Sometimes it just needs some movement to unbind. (unless this is an electrical issue)
